Brian ran 414 miles in 34 of an hour. How fast was Brian running? 3316 mph 312 mph 5 mph 523 mph

Answer: Fourth option is correct.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we have given that

Distance traveled by Brian = 4\frac{1}{4}\ miles=\frac{17}{4}\ miles

Time taken by him = \frac{3}{4} of an hour

So, Speed at which Brian is running fast is given by

Speed=\dfrac{Distance}{Time}\\\\\\Speed=\dfrac{\dfrac{17}{4}}{\dfrac{3}{4}}\\\\\\Speed=\dfrac{17}{3}\\\\\\Speed=5\dfrac{2}{3}\ mph

Hence, Brian was running fast at 5\dfrac{2}{3}\ mph

Therefore, Fourth option is correct.

What is the mean of 13,6,8,6,15
Luden [163]

Hey there!

To start, the mean of the answer is also known as the average value of a set of numbers. This is calculated by dividing the sum of the set by the total amount of numbers.

In this case the sum of all the numbers is 13 + 6 + 8 + 6 + 15 which is equal to 48.

Now, divide 48 by the total number of numbers in the set: 48/5 = 9.6

Your final answer should be 9.6, or you can leave it in fraction form as 48/5.
